So this is OP when you compare it to stuff like Wind-Ups? (Yes lousy example, but it kinda of helps my point)?

The card is specific, it requires set up, and as Black has said, most of its targets are pointless to actually use as Xyz. Added to the fact that Heraldric Beasts as of yet have no way to easily set up the grave by themselves, this is just a casual card for now.

The fundimentals behind it are pretty much the same as rabbit and Tour Guide, except this isn't splashable, and requires some set-up, not much but some. They even keep you from tagging other things in to make free shock masters everywhere (That would be just stupid)

Now feel free to disagree with my view, which is probably lousy due to lack of sleep, but as it is, its not OP. It might be unfair, but not OP.

Heraldics are terrible. They rarely go into +s, they have only 1 card that "swarms" (and that needs 2 other heraldics on the field to do so), and none of them save for Leo and Aberconway have decent ATK. As it stands, the card isn't OP because its targets are crap, but if Konami releases decent heraldic monsters in the upcoming WIND pack, then the card would probably be widely considered unfair and OP.

They have an abusable searcher that searchers every time it touches the grave, albeit only one time per turn. They have a +1 from the grave that adds said searcher/other Heraldics to hand. They have their own Reborn. They have their own Miracle Fusion that works for any 2 Material R4 whose conditions they meet.

They need a RotA or 2 decent monsters to be at least genuinely playable. That's it.
